    i wouldnt use the 10% ethanol.

    the car isnt deisgned for it.

    i use 98 octane BP ultimate in my carby ed

    i get at least 100km more a tank than with e10 or 91 octane

    so you might think that it costs less to fill up with e10, but youre getting less kms a tank, so it becomes less worth it
